區域的開閉運算
開運算
開運算 = 先腐蝕運算,再膨脹運算(看上去把細微連在一起的兩塊目标分開了)
開運算總結:
(1)開運算能夠除去孤立的小點,毛刺和小橋,而總的位置和形狀不便。
(2)開運算是一個基于幾何運算的濾波器。
(3)結構元素大小的不同将導緻濾波效果的不同。
(4)不同的結構元素的選擇導緻了不同的分割,即提取出不同的特征。
閉運算
閉運算 = 先膨脹運算,再腐蝕運算(看上去将兩個細微連接配接的圖塊封閉在一起)
閉運算的效果圖如下圖所示:
閉運算總結:
(1)閉運算能夠填平小湖(即小孔),彌合小裂縫,而總的位置和形狀不變。
(2)閉運算是通過填充圖像的凹角來濾波圖像的。
(3)結構元素大小的不同将導緻濾波效果的不同。
(4)不同結構元素的選擇導緻了不同的分割。
灰階圖的開閉運算
若我們把重合區域(也就是核)中所有點灰階值的最大值賦給目前點,就是對灰階圖的膨脹操作
若我們把重合區域中所有點灰階值的最小值賦給目前點,就是對灰階圖的腐蝕操作
閉運算
下圖為原圖像
膨脹後的圖檔(這裡膨脹采用的是20行1列的核心,故豎線被消掉了)
在上圖的基礎上,腐蝕後的圖檔(依舊是同樣的核心)
開運算
在上圖的基礎上進行開運算,先腐蝕
再膨脹
參考文獻
形态學應用——圖像腐蝕與膨脹
形态學應用——圖像開運算與閉運算